Lines Matching refs:fileoff
307 scp->fileoff = scp32->fileoff; in widen_segment_command()
1083 if (is_dyld && scp->vmaddr == 0 && scp->fileoff == 0) { in parse_machfile()
1146 if (ret == LOAD_SUCCESS && scp->fileoff == 0 && scp->filesize > 0) { in parse_machfile()
1166 if (is_dyld && scp64->vmaddr == 0 && scp64->fileoff == 0) { in parse_machfile()
1201 if (ret == LOAD_SUCCESS && scp64->fileoff == 0 && scp64->filesize > 0) { in parse_machfile()
2105 pager_offset + scp->fileoff, in load_segment()
2106 pager_offset + scp->fileoff + scp->filesize, in load_segment()
2116 if (scp->fileoff + scp->filesize < scp->fileoff || in load_segment()
2117 scp->fileoff + scp->filesize > (uint64_t)macho_size) { in load_segment()
2118 …DEBUG4K_ERROR("LOAD_BADMACHO fileoff 0x%llx filesize 0x%llx macho_size 0x%llx\n", scp->fileoff, sc… in load_segment()
2132 if (os_add_overflow(pager_offset, scp->fileoff, &file_offset)) { in load_segment()
2133 DEBUG4K_ERROR("LOAD_BADMACHO file_offset: 0x%llx + 0x%llx\n", pager_offset, scp->fileoff); in load_segment()
2167 result->cs_end_offset < (off_t)scp->fileoff && in load_segment()
2168 result->cs_end_offset - scp->fileoff < scp->filesize) { in load_segment()
2172 …fset 0x%llx fileoff 0x%llx filesize 0x%llx\n", result->cs_end_offset, scp->fileoff, scp->filesize); in load_segment()
2451 if ((scp->fileoff == 0) && (scp->filesize != 0)) { in load_segment()
3375 if ((seg64->fileoff <= eip->cryptoff) && in set_code_unprotect()
3376 (seg64->fileoff + seg64->filesize >= in set_code_unprotect()
3378 map_offset = (vm_map_offset_t)(seg64->vmaddr + eip->cryptoff - seg64->fileoff + slide); in set_code_unprotect()
3386 if ((seg32->fileoff <= eip->cryptoff) && in set_code_unprotect()
3387 (seg32->fileoff + seg32->filesize >= in set_code_unprotect()
3389 map_offset = (vm_map_offset_t)(seg32->vmaddr + eip->cryptoff - seg32->fileoff + slide); in set_code_unprotect()